Cannondale's introduction of BB30a, which is incompatible with regular BB30 cranksets just means that in the future it's very likely that BB30 cranksets will have longer spindles. With spacers, they will work with an BB30 BB, so there's no worry about "future proofing". Also there are many adapters that allow for use of Shimano cranks and others, in many ways a BB30 bottom bracket is very broadly compatible with all cranks currently available, and I would guess, will remain so for a long time.
On the other hand, my experience with BB30 and pressfit BBs in general has lead me to avoid them in future, I didn't like having to get my BB replaced 3 times in a year (the third time when I did it myself and locitited it, does seem to have held up OK). But there are many on here that will tell you that BB30 problems are entirely the fault of the installer, others who will tell you it's a fundamentally flawed system.
